Curb cleaning services typically involve the thorough removal of dirt, grime, algae, moss, and stains from the surfaces surrounding a property, such as driveways, walkways, patios, and steps. These services often utilize high-pressure washing equipment and specialized cleaning solutions to restore the appearance of outdoor surfaces. Regular curb cleaning can help maintain a property's curb appeal, making it look well-kept and inviting. It also prepares surfaces for sealing or other treatments, which can extend their lifespan and improve safety by reducing slippery buildup.

Many common problems can be addressed through professional curb cleaning. Over time, outdoor surfaces can accumulate algae, mold, and moss, especially in shaded or damp areas, leading to slippery conditions that pose safety risks. Dirt and stains from vehicle leaks, falling leaves, or general foot traffic can also cause surfaces to look dull and unattractive. In addition to improving aesthetics, curb cleaning can help prevent the deterioration of concrete, brick, or stone surfaces caused by moss and grime, ultimately saving money on repairs or replacements in the long run.

The overview below groups typical Curb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cherry Hill,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ic curb cleaning or minor repairs typ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s in Cherry Hill, NJ.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, depending on the scope and condition of the curb.

Mid-Range Projects - Larger repairs or partial replacements usually fall between $600 and $1,500. These projects often involve more extensive work and are common for residential properties needing moderate curb restoration.

Full Replacement - Complete curb replacements can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, especially for longer or more complex projects. Fewer projects reach the highest tiers, but they are necessary for severely damaged or outdated curbs.

Complex or Custom Work - Custom designs or highly detailed curb work can exceed $5,000, depending on size and materials.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ve specialized craftsmanship or unique specifications.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
